Antioxidant and Anti-Arthritic Activity of Bombax buonopozense P. Beauv. Leaves

CONCLUSION: Phytochemical screening revealed the presence of flavonoids, alkaloids, and phenolics. The brine shrimp lethality assay of the crude extract and fractions gave LC50 value ≥ 1000 µg/mL, compared to Cyclophosphamide (LC50 = 224.7±0.35µg/mL). The BBME had TPC value of 19.8±0.56 mg GAE/g, while the TFC of ethyl acetate fraction was the highest (173.5±0.05 mg QE/g). The ethyl acetate fraction has the highest antioxidant activity (IC50 = 20.96±0.23 µg/mL) as compared to ascorbic acid (2.8±0.01) and rutin (20.6±9.26 µg/mL). BBME significantly reduced the paw circumference. BBME (400 mg/kg) prevented biochemical changes to a greater extent than Celecoxib (20 mg/kg). Bombax buonopozense leaves could be an effective antiarthritic and holds prospect in the treatment of rheumatoid arthritis.PMID:38367936 | DOI:10.1016/j.pharma.2024.02.008
